description

Luton Council is committed to providing a fair and equitable procurement process for services that we commission. The Council provides a range of services for vulnerable members of the community that are funded from central government grants. The charitable and voluntary sector, and in some cases the private sector, are able to provide the skills and experience to provide these services more appropriately than the Council and therefore the Council will want to enter into contracts with these organisations to provide the services.

Luton Council Housing Needs Department have designed this Trusted Partner Process in order to maintain a transparent and competitive tender process for short term, quick turnaround, grant funding.

This project is covered by the light touch regime.
